Types of Custom Doors Installation Projects
Custom doors installation can come in a wider variety of scenarios than a simple ‘new build’ door hang. Heritage and period homes can sometimes create the most difficult installation challenges as over the years door openings have shifted, settled or been altered and are no longer square. In these cases, the door must be fitted to the specific opening it is installed in and will not fit a standard door opening without being measured and possibly adjusted to the frame; therefore, careful measurements and adjustments to the frame may be necessary. French door installation is more complicated because both leaves must move in perfect synchrony and match the frame for smooth operation and to close flush. Entry door units are a door with a frame around it, with a threshold and weatherseal, and have more parts and failure points than the door alone and more crucial points for professional installation. Installing an internal door in a house that has non-standard ceiling heights and/or non-square openings is also a similar fitting issue that will need experience to get right – without leaving any visible marks.
What Professional Custom Doors Installation Involves
Custom doors installation starts with a comprehensive evaluation of the opening itself prior to installation. The condition of the frame, the plumb and level are all checked and if remedial work is to be done, it is done before the door is introduced as this could make matters worse. The door is then fitted with suitable hinges, hardware and latches for its weight and usage, hinges are mounted and recessed correctly so that the door hangs straight and swings freely without binding. Fitted where necessary, weatherseals, thresholds and draught excluders are used, especially at external doors where energy efficiency and weather resistance are important. After hanging, the door is adjusted and tested for the complete door travel, with latches, locks and other hardware installed and tested afterwards. The amount of care given at each step is what will determine the performance of the door over the years to come.
